Product Description

The National Instruments PCI-4065 Digital Multimeter is a high-resolution device with 6.5 digits of accuracy and part numbers 779770-01 and 190310C-01.

It is capable of a wide range of measurements including voltage conversion from analog to digital and vice versa, current measurements, resistance testing in either 2 or 4-wire configurations, and diode testing. The multimeter has a voltage range of ±300 V for both DC and RMS measurements, and boasts a maximum sample rate of 3 kS/s.

With a basic DC voltage accuracy of 90 ppm, the PCI-4065 ensures precision in its readings and is recommended to be calibrated at least once per year to maintain its accuracy. The device also supports current measurements up to 3 A and relies on the NI-DMM driver software for operation.

The multimeter is portable with a weight of 11.5 oz and dimensions of 7.2 x 0.8 x 4.7 inches. It is designed to operate within a temperature range of 0 to 40 °C and can be safely stored between -40 °C to 70 °C.
